-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Format: 1.8 Date: Tue, 01 Feb 2011 17:14:21 +0100 Source: postgresql-8.4 Binary: libpq-dev libpq5 libecpg6 libecpg-dev libecpg-compat3 libpgtypes3 postgresql-8.4 postgresql-client-8.4 postgresql-server-dev-8.4 postgresql-doc-8.4 postgresql-contrib-8.4 postgresql-plperl-8.4 postgresql-plpython-8.4 postgresql-pltcl-8.4 postgresql postgresql-client postgresql-doc postgresql-contrib Architecture: s390 Version: 8.4.7-0squeeze2 Distribution: squeeze-security Urgency: high Maintainer: s390 Build Daemon (zandonai) Changed-By: Martin Pitt Description: libecpg-compat3 - older version of run-time library for ECPG programs libecpg-dev - development files for ECPG (Embedded PostgreSQL for C) libecpg6 - run-time library for ECPG programs libpgtypes3 - shared library libpgtypes for PostgreSQL 8.4 libpq-dev - header files for libpq5 (PostgreSQL library) libpq5 - PostgreSQL C client library postgresql - object-relational SQL database (supported version) postgresql-8.4 - object-relational SQL database, version 8.4 server postgresql-client - front-end programs for PostgreSQL (supported version) postgresql-client-8.4 - front-end programs for PostgreSQL 8.4 postgresql-contrib - additional facilities for PostgreSQL (supported version) postgresql-contrib-8.4 - additional facilities for PostgreSQL postgresql-doc - documentation for the PostgreSQL database management system postgresql-doc-8.4 - documentation for the PostgreSQL database management system postgresql-plperl-8.4 - PL/Perl procedural language for PostgreSQL 8.4 postgresql-plpython-8.4 - PL/Python procedural language for PostgreSQL 8.4 postgresql-pltcl-8.4 - PL/Tcl procedural language for PostgreSQL 8.4 postgresql-server-dev-8.4 - development files for PostgreSQL 8.4 server-side programming Changes: postgresql-8.4 (8.4.7-0squeeze2) stable-security; urgency=high . * New upstream security/bug fix release: - Fix buffer overrun in "contrib/intarray"'s input function for the query_int type. This bug is a security risk since the function's return address could be overwritten. Thanks to Apple Inc's security team for reporting this issue and supplying the fix. (CVE-2010-4015) - Avoid failures when "EXPLAIN" tries to display a simple-form CASE expression. If the CASE's test expression was a constant, the planner could simplify the CASE into a form that confused the expression-display code, resulting in "unexpected CASE WHEN clause" errors. - Fix assignment to an array slice that is before the existing range of subscripts. If there was a gap between the newly added subscripts and the first pre-existing subscript, the code miscalculated how many entries needed to be copied from the old array's null bitmap, potentially leading to data corruption or crash. - Avoid unexpected conversion overflow in planner for very distant date values. The date type supports a wider range of dates than can be represented by the timestamp types, but the planner assumed it could always convert a date to timestamp with impunity. - Fix pg_restore's text output for large objects (BLOBs) when standard_conforming_strings is on. Although restoring directly to a database worked correctly, string escaping was incorrect if pg_restore was asked for SQL text output and standard_conforming_strings had been enabled in the source database. - Fix erroneous parsing of tsquery values containing ... & !(subexpression) | ... . Queries containing this combination of operators were not executed correctly. The same error existed in "contrib/intarray"'s query_int type and "contrib/ltree"'s ltxtquery type. - Fix bug in "contrib/seg"'s GiST picksplit algorithm. This could result in considerable inefficiency, though not actually incorrect answers, in a GiST index on a seg column. If you have such an index, consider "REINDEX"ing it after installing this update. (This is identical to the bug that was fixed in "contrib/cube" in the previous update.) Checksums-Sha1: 153296c7f39cf83ec8b01ae0fa89d3b5dbf1c205 238006 libpq-dev_8.4.7-0squeeze2_s390.deb 09552693595c14b99f8f845d442ef0e13767377d 156148 libpq5_8.4.7-0squeeze2_s390.deb 4299bbe3c225fbba6f1cb9fb227f409f95957b11 89726 libecpg6_8.4.7-0squeeze2_s390.deb bee16bda3d70b2759e8fd0d4fcb4471f01794fad 259602 libecpg-dev_8.4.7-0squeeze2_s390.deb 94125c58f117b43ae086d528cf7a30345e30a0b3 28474 libecpg-compat3_8.4.7-0squeeze2_s390.deb f98dd9076869e75f5f74b9bc94cc8335e80f987f 54526 libpgtypes3_8.4.7-0squeeze2_s390.deb 60ab527fe1debabda60e5ff157a8501e49e9ed7c 5732066 postgresql-8.4_8.4.7-0squeeze2_s390.deb 37ef1902f1985de0d92a5fea307ed122f2c1243a 1478028 postgresql-client-8.4_8.4.7-0squeeze2_s390.deb 6ec6f76c615dbf21bd3b8ed2ce2121b176a51541 641070 postgresql-server-dev-8.4_8.4.7-0squeeze2_s390.deb 28f222f70c9ba1ba9bbef05f6a025de6a3edd906 431180 postgresql-contrib-8.4_8.4.7-0squeeze2_s390.deb 6f2208a9e6f7b021ffac4dce507f80dbea2a25dd 54242 postgresql-plperl-8.4_8.4.7-0squeeze2_s390.deb f50027d89295d81feb90f6c6c9aed0f42079e3f0 56086 postgresql-plpython-8.4_8.4.7-0squeeze2_s390.deb 9bab83a9b7760c3b30752b4ff47ad17da04be6e0 42660 postgresql-pltcl-8.4_8.4.7-0squeeze2_s390.deb Checksums-Sha256: 923aa05bc4e7defc7f62c9e7b551738290c9129619bbdae302a1f06903f9b6c2 238006 libpq-dev_8.4.7-0squeeze2_s390.deb b7b7590f7025911c4501448fc91387f2bc58ff83c2cdeddce36315846c9ed216 156148 libpq5_8.4.7-0squeeze2_s390.deb a7255220e41d4be65c819e52f664989b7b6461c2d9fc0cb27fc63b028792e0d9 89726 libecpg6_8.4.7-0squeeze2_s390.deb 6289adcd99bae2b3d4c0fedf4406574624d937cfa6e2444df3d118b5f72cdeb3 259602 libecpg-dev_8.4.7-0squeeze2_s390.deb 0b996b0ebf6f33d08ea3c6a840a71dc457f87add4f61d07811cd87c8c664fdd6 28474 libecpg-compat3_8.4.7-0squeeze2_s390.deb fde1d7afc0f18ef34cef2a53102c06e20871a8caac27a0f6bb07c7d792e92734 54526 libpgtypes3_8.4.7-0squeeze2_s390.deb c4857019368d87745a8ca1db979f4da4f8d38c73224b61127b84c1cc0c36a2fb 5732066 postgresql-8.4_8.4.7-0squeeze2_s390.deb 163d7b2b74f58bf37dee66db9274a48f16761c5a7ee3c61e975a3d47ae2c7fa1 1478028 postgresql-client-8.4_8.4.7-0squeeze2_s390.deb c2f4a2e46043610ef284439b4cf825cbecede35cc27005d2adf994386004b303 641070 postgresql-server-dev-8.4_8.4.7-0squeeze2_s390.deb d5152dd0a404bae83f84e286dd2f68fd4dfa7371cc5f6924b699e7c615a72d58 431180 postgresql-contrib-8.4_8.4.7-0squeeze2_s390.deb 327580d5f42f793f53902d2fcaaf1c520868dbf3b4227917495f664632527502 54242 postgresql-plperl-8.4_8.4.7-0squeeze2_s390.deb 4651d4517bbe576d6d75a21a4b9d0d390d4934de734a9f9b9d292b5cae3431d4 56086 postgresql-plpython-8.4_8.4.7-0squeeze2_s390.deb 3aa1bec06a19650771b1c4f5bb762ca2f6c4073ef28d6fbc8fac9fb7aaa6bb4b 42660 postgresql-pltcl-8.4_8.4.7-0squeeze2_s390.deb Files: 0d6fa4abc9ada98505f36a33c9153998 238006 libdevel optional libpq-dev_8.4.7-0squeeze2_s390.deb 1d085094a92bb208a2c297e2a0c05ddc 156148 libs optional libpq5_8.4.7-0squeeze2_s390.deb 2ac45323de36d5c08cb912dd53c40f28 89726 libs optional libecpg6_8.4.7-0squeeze2_s390.deb 492777d47d06d02b67c880569f018657 259602 libdevel optional libecpg-dev_8.4.7-0squeeze2_s390.deb f7bcaba80bc87c6a46eaa5ae9dcbf8ec 28474 libs optional libecpg-compat3_8.4.7-0squeeze2_s390.deb 81432fd60af1a105e3f9712a181ec9d8 54526 libs optional libpgtypes3_8.4.7-0squeeze2_s390.deb 86c2dd8e04a4da09a495f5ac76d10956 5732066 database optional postgresql-8.4_8.4.7-0squeeze2_s390.deb efbcaf6557700fa71c9913c0fbabee62 1478028 database optional postgresql-client-8.4_8.4.7-0squeeze2_s390.deb c51a10d24e24248539704d1821eaf868 641070 libdevel optional postgresql-server-dev-8.4_8.4.7-0squeeze2_s390.deb 201db050b2694a7fd7df37850ea6a1dd 431180 database optional postgresql-contrib-8.4_8.4.7-0squeeze2_s390.deb 7b5ef4e3e00886405066fb6e5d19e6b0 54242 database optional postgresql-plperl-8.4_8.4.7-0squeeze2_s390.deb ad32e8c38b2b9e2a757c542615e30c1c 56086 database optional postgresql-plpython-8.4_8.4.7-0squeeze2_s390.deb 3d9225a20bbf82429a5a6802eb6c953a 42660 database optional postgresql-pltcl-8.4_8.4.7-0squeeze2_s390.deb -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.9 (GNU/Linux) iQEcBAEBAgAGBQJNUeeuAAoJEL97/wQC1SS+XFsIAIGYbI2OvLji19Sb20wGeKuA O1MbX2jdPWYcTo8b8XBsAZFxGCWbQEjhFzhX7b9rlWFWuaQeWM1s2WL2up+hOCtK m00Fg4LWqxNBlBfD+uTo09j1P6y6379pc2ZN3tdPkZ6slb9Jb0H7OSxmTClcnuYF XLD2JpH76ie/2Lgo3u/4o2jW8gFmMEf1vn5/c5EDkzV3qJh9Jue6UTMfcq2DtxaH tSTqcxouWYXbp3SKrKYz3i30+YLm9nSQIV1rGWErEKwa9ZmLE9E7b7kAEDaGGw45 0RmDONQA+NqcQB70MFggzZLE/meQIEynUJyki4dHsxlTmZLiZRK1+bQmB58KgqU= =k1pG -----END PGP SIGNATURE-----